Describe the visit as well as the treatment

A day spa website should help someone imagine the practical shape of a visit. Explain the treatments the business actually offers, how bookings are arranged, and what arrival information guests receive. Separate a single appointment from a package containing several services. A calming image can set the mood, but it cannot tell a visitor which parts of the experience are included.

Make packages easy to compare

List each package component, its stated appointment time, and any choices the guest needs to make. Distinguish treatment time from the broader time someone may want to allow at the venue. Use only details approved by the spa. If a package requires coordination between staff members, explain whether the website accepts a request or confirms a complete schedule.

Give gifts their own explanation

A gift purchaser may be choosing for someone whose preferences they do not know. Explain the difference between buying a particular package and purchasing a gift value, where those options exist. Link the spa's current redemption terms beside the purchase action. Describe delivery clearly, including whether the gift is digital or physical, without promising a delivery time the business cannot support.

Prepare a calm, clear booking route

Collect treatment descriptions, actual package contents, arrival instructions, approved photography, booking links, and current gift terms. Test buying a gift separately from booking a visit. A gift purchase should not appear to reserve a treatment unless that is how the spa's system works.

Watch which package pages lead to booking requests and which questions the reception team still answers. Confusion about package contents can often be resolved with a clearer comparison. Keep wellness claims out of decorative marketing copy unless the business has reviewed and can support them. The site's job is to explain the available experience and make the next conversation or booking easier.
